Mentor Kansas seeking students to form Young Leaders Council

Council members will act as ambassadors, participate in leadership development program

Mentor Kansas is searching for five inspiring youth leaders to form a Young Leaders Council. Applications are being accepted now through March 18, 2022, at www.mentorkansas.org.

Applicants need to:

  • Be either a Kansas junior or senior in high school or enrolled in a General Education Development (GED) program.
  • Be 18 years of age or younger.
  • Demonstrate a solid commitment to volunteerism and service.

 

The Mentor Kansas Young Leaders Council offers youth an opportunity to participate in a leadership development program while acting as ambassadors for Mentor Kansas.

The Council is being created to elevate youth voice and contribute to Mentor Kansas strategic initiatives, while also providing young people with a unique opportunity to move their ideas from conceptualization to implementation and reflection. Council members will receive an honorarium for their participation.

"Youth voice is critical and necessary to drive the work we do in our organization, and understanding the challenges facing them must come from young people themselves," said Paula Smith, director of Mentor Kansas.

Organizations and educators are invited to encourage youth of all backgrounds and abilities to apply. The Mentor Kansas Young Leaders Council membership will be announced on March 29, 2022.

For more information about the Mentor Kansas Young Leaders Council or Mentor Kansas, contact Smith at mentor@ksde.org or psmith@ksde.org.

The mission of Mentor Kansas is to promote safe and effective youth mentoring practices and inspire more Kansans to be mentors. Mentor Kansas is a program of the Kansas Volunteer Commission and the Kansas State Department of Education.

MENTOR: The National Mentoring Partnership is providing the initial funding for the Mentor Kansas Young Leaders Council.
